A World Juniors stacked with draft-eligible talent has come and gone, league play has picked up, and plenty of notable players are already finding their footing with new teams. 

Our scouting staff has convened for the third time and assembled a top-75, and there’s a new No. 1: Ivar Stenberg

Swapping long-term favourite for No. 1, Gavin McKenna, with Stenberg wasn’t a decision a scouting team took easily. There were plenty of debates, but the central theme kept back to two things: Stenberg closing the gap as a playmaker, while bringing more physically and away from the puck. Additionally, he looks ready to make an NHL impact as soon as next fall.
